Color Psychology
Magenta is a stimulating, attention-commanding color that bridges passion and imagination. It represents transformation, artistic vision, and unconventional thinking. Magenta disrupts expectations and is associated with innovation and bold self-expression.
Design Usage
Medium magentas are powerful for brands that want to project creativity and boldness. They create eye-catching gradients when blended with purple or orange tones. Use sparingly as accent colors for maximum impact in otherwise restrained designs.

Frequently Asked Questions
What are the RGB, HSL, and CMYK values of #895591?
RGB(137, 85, 145) · HSL(292.0, 26.1%, 45.1%) · CMYK(5.5%, 41.4%, 0.0%, 43.1%)
Does #895591 meet WCAG contrast on white?
5.57:1 — WCAG AA Pass, AAA Fail for normal text.
What text color is readable on #895591?
Use FFFFFF text on a #895591 background; contrast on black is 3.77:1.
